Transaction 5e6c9e141fcdd0b2c84f0c7321afc7c8a28608cce123d3d62836a235f3dafe3e

2 Input
2 Outputs
  • 5e6c9e141fcdd0b2c84f0c7321afc7c8a28608cce123d3d62836a235f3dafe3e:0
  • value  21405249
    address  34CKX6WkFxHepMYxNjH7RuXPDP2HyeEt1e
  • 5e6c9e141fcdd0b2c84f0c7321afc7c8a28608cce123d3d62836a235f3dafe3e:1
  • value  123482185
    address  1D9Xat6jsDoRZceoTKyndiXN59aJ1LhCXb